    When the user requirements are very clear we could directly start making the product. The development work starts right away. It is called the Waterfall model of development.

    However, when the user's requirements are not known or the user does not know very well what he/she wants, then we need to follow a prototyping model of development.

    We start with a low scaled prototype and show it to the customer. Then depending on the real feedback of the customer, we develop the actual version of the product.  
   
    This saves money, effort , waste of work and resources. It may take longer. But is is better this way.
